Once you’ve decided on ceiling removal, preparation is key. First, ensure that all furniture is moved out of the work area to prevent damage. It’s also important to cover floors and remaining fixtures to protect them from debris. Always consider hiring professionals who have experience in safely conducting such renovations, especially if the ceiling contains hazardous materials like asbestos.
The method used for removing a ceiling depends on its material and construction. Most commonly, drywall ceilings are taken down using specialized tools. This process involves cutting sections into manageable pieces before carefully detaching them from the supporting structures. Ensure safety measures are followed diligently throughout the procedure.
Following removal, homeowners often seek fresh alternatives to enhance their interiors. Options include installing suspended ceilings, applying new paint textures, or introducing exposed beams for an industrial look. Each choice brings a unique character and benefits to your home’s ambiance.
